Output d63fbc4e46415bb6d7febc0c23ad2dd89061455fa2eabbdc63a932d8a16f34ec:1

value
1744829
script pubkey
OP_0 OP_PUSHBYTES_20 07129a9f4fccae6fc129011fe68f419099d00c2f
address
bc1qquff4860ejhxlsffqy07dr6pjzvaqrp0uccqg5
transaction
d63fbc4e46415bb6d7febc0c23ad2dd89061455fa2eabbdc63a932d8a16f34ec
confirmations
204003
spent
true